1. Xterra Treadmill

This model is made by XTERRA Fitness is an affordable folding treadmill with incline treadmill argos options that can be used to help improve your health. While it's not equipped with the bells and whistles of pricier models, it still offers a decent warranty package and is a solid choice when you're seeking a basic treadmill to take walks or short jogs on. It can be bought on the internet and delivered straight to your doorstep.

Its heart-pounding speed range of up to 12 mph is fueled by a smooth and quiet 2.75 HP motor. The XTRASoft cushioned decking technology helps reduce joint strain while making your exercise more comfortable. This treadmill features a 20" 60" running surface that has a 0-12% incline for an intense workout. The 6.5" LCD screen and the handlebar mounted speed controls as well as incline controls allow you to customize your workout.

A wireless chest strap heart rate monitor and hand pulse sensors provide you with the ability to monitor your heart rate throughout your workout. The console also has 12 built-in programs to keep you inspired to push yourself in every workout. When you're done exercising it's simple to fold the console up and out of the way thanks to the Lift Assist design. A storage tray and accessory holders are included to hold your water bottle, reading materials, remote control, and more.

The TR625 treadmill from XTERRA is another option for those seeking a basic treadmill that can aid in getting fit. Its sturdy frame is able to support individuals of any size and shape with a maximum capacity of 350 pounds. The XTERRA treadmill has a 20" 60" running surface and can reach a maximum speed of 12 mph. There are a variety of programs to help you achieve your fitness goals, and cooling fans are built in to ensure that you stay comfortable during workouts.

In contrast to other treadmills, the XTERRA Fitness does not have an automatic incline feature. However, it has an adjustable incline switch that allows you to manually change the speed of your treadmill during your workouts. This treadmill comes with an integrated reading rack, built-in speakers and convenient cup and accessory holders.

2. Horizon Treadmill 7.0 AT

With a price that is less than $1,000 The Horizon Treadmill 7.0 AT is an excellent treadmill that folds with an incline for those who want to reclaim their home gym from equipment that eats up space each time they work out. Its compact, easy-to-use style is backed by a solid set of customer reviews that highlight its durability and space-saving abilities.

The treadmill has 20" x 60" running belt that's one of the biggest decks of any folding treadmill, as well as a suspension system with variable response under the belt that offers different layers of cushioning over three deck zones. The front zone features more robust cushioning to provide support for impacts. The middle zone is more cushioning for recovery and push-offs. The back zone is a mix of both.

This Horizon treadmill is, in addition to having 10 built-in programs is compatible with online workout applications like Peloton, Zwift and Studio. This is a fantastic feature given the direction that the fitness industry has taken in recent years, and is an impressive move on Horizon's part.

The 7.0 AT includes two Bluetooth speakers that cover the display. This is ideal for those who would rather listen to music rather than wear headphones while exercising. It also comes with a multi-position tablet holder, USB charging ports, and an energy saver mode to allow you to maximize the enjoyment of your walk or run. The 7.0 AT is a plug-and play treadmill, so you don't need to worry about additional cords or attachments. Some online reviews have noted that the Bluetooth on the treadmill might not function consistently. This could be a hassle.

It's a big machine, weighing 277 pounds, which will require some strength to move around if you need to reposition it after exercising. It is easy to clean and maintain because it folds quickly. Furthermore, the ability to fold of this treadmill makes it ideal to store in a cramped space or an apartment setting. This treadmill is one of the few that locks into place using the foot latch that is a good measure to keep children or pets from messing with your fitness equipment.

3. Echelon Treadmill

Echelon isn't a major brand, but this treadmill offers many benefits to fitness at a reasonable price. It can walk, jog or run (up to 12.5 miles per hour) and can adjust the incline to give you more resistance. Its touchscreen connects to the internet via Bluetooth or Echelon membership plans (starting at $29 a month with a 2 year plan that is annually paid or $33 for a monthly payment or $40 per year for a payment) which unlocks live classes, rankings, and more.

Its minimalist design is attractive and fits well in any house. It's also solid, and its 60 x 20 inch running deck is the standard size for treadmills similar to this. It's also very easy to use, thanks to its auto-fold feature (just push levers on under the handlebars). It folds flat and is only 10 inches high and you can store it in a closet, or even lean it against a wall.

You can also pair the treadmill with headphones to listen to audiobooks or music. It has an integrated fan to keep you cool while you work out, and two bottle holders to hold water or other workout beverages. It also has heart rate sensors built into the handlebars, which are an excellent addition. And its console has simple buttons to adjust the speed and incline and an emergency stop button.

The treadmill with incline of 12 is a good machine, but it's missing some key features that would make it more effective. For example it doesn't work with third-party fitness apps, such as iFit, which means you can only take classes that are offered through Echelon. This isn't an issue however it could be an issue for some customers.

Another issue is the cost. Although this treadmill is affordable, it's still slightly more expensive than other models. 4. Sunny Health & Fitness Treadmill

This treadmill folds and has an incline from Sunny Health and Fitness is a great choice for beginners who don't want a top-of-the-line machine that will cost you a fortune. It features an ultra-compact, foldable frame with 9 pre-built programs and an maximum speed of 9 miles per hour. It also has a small LCD screen that displays your time and distance as well as calories burned. Soft grips are easy to clean and are gentle on your hands. The treadmill folds down and can be easily removed thanks to its wheels for transport, so you can store it in the closet or move it away when you're not using it.

The premium features on this treadmill will make your workouts exciting and rewarding. It is able to be synchronized with your mobile devices via Bluetooth. This gives you access to over 1000plus workouts and 10,000+ scenic global routes that you can use to reach your fitness goals.

In addition, this premium treadmill comes with 12 incline levels (from 0 to 12%) to boost the intensity of your workout and target various muscles. Auto-incline is simple to use and allows you to adjust the incline level without changing speed or duration. It also has a built-in heart rate monitor that uses the pulse of your body to track your heart rate during your exercise.

Another excellent feature of this treadmill is its cushioned running deck which absorbs much of the impact from your foot strike and offers a more comfortable experience than road running. It can also help you run longer since it reduces the strain on your legs and joints.

reebok-sl8-0-treadmill-bluetooth-802.jpgThe folding mechanism of this treadmill is simple to use and has a soft-drop hydraulic system that will prevent damage to your flooring when opening and closing it. The storage tray lets you to keep your water bottle and other things while you work out. The handrail controls, phone/tablet holder and control panel are convenient. The running deck can be folded upwards when not in use and it has a maximum weight capacity of 240 pounds.
